Subject: Quickstore 4.2 — bloom filter now fronts the KV layer

Plugin authors: starting with this release, Quickstore places a bloom filter ahead of the key-value store. Negative lookups return faster; false positives fall through safely. No API changes are required on your side. Verify your plugin against the staging build referenced below.

session token of fahif-tadup = htk3_9c7

Subject: Key rotation for InvoiceForge renderer

Welcome, new folks. Every quarter we rotate the credential the Pellworth PDF invoice renderer uses to call our internal asset service, Vaultline. The old key stops working Friday at noon. Update your local .env and the staging config before then, and verify a test invoice renders with the new embedded fonts. For convenience, the freshly issued key is included here.

app token of bagef-bageg = kto11_vuwA0uhrEMg

Hey Larkspur team,

Quick heads-up: we're moving the Ostera connector build onto our hermetic system, Kilnbox, next sprint. No more network fetches mid-build, so vendored deps only. Your integration tests should pass unchanged, but flag anything weird in review. To pull the sealed toolchain image from our registry, use the bearer token below.

portal login ticket: eyJhbGciOiJIUzI1NiIsInR5cCI6IkpXVCJ9.eyJzdWIiOiIwEOsktwVNwIn0.-UJU3fdyyCgG

## Onboarding — Markdown Pipeline (Inkmere)

Inkmere docs render through a three-stage pipeline: parse, sanitize, emit. Releases rebuild all templates; never hot-patch emitted HTML. Broken renders usually mean a sanitizer rule change — check the rules diff first. The render cluster only accepts builds from the release channel, and every build artifact must be signed before upload. Sign artifacts with the deploy key below.

release key, hafop-tajef: bky13_s2vaFVNJTHfBL

FAQ: Why does a large spreadsheet export fail in Tablemint?

Exports above roughly 400,000 rows can exhaust the worker's memory limit and abort. Advise customers to use chunked export mode, which streams rows in batches. If the export worker's credential store locks after repeated failures, unseal it using the recovery passphrase appended directly below this entry.

strongbox words: druwyn-lamvan-julath-sorox-ralius-wenael-briiel-aldiel-ulaius-belath-casath-ulamir-ulair-norir